Mask Network takes over Lens Protocol with goal to build ‘products people actually use’

The Block
Mask Network will now steward the next chapter of Lens Protocol, aiming to build consumer-grade social products.

Summary

Lens Protocol, initially launched by Aave founder Stani Kulechov in early 2022 as a decentralized social infrastructure on Polygon, is transitioning its stewardship to Mask Network for its next phase. Kulechov stated their goal was to create neutral infrastructure for developers to build mainstream-capable applications. Mask Network announced its vision is shifting focus from creating more protocols to developing "products people actually use," emphasizing culture and thriving communities. Mask Network is also known for supporting the decentralized social ecosystem Mastodon. This transition occurs while other SocialFi projects, like Farcaster, have pivoted away from their original social media focus due to struggles appealing to mainstream users.
